Statement

Polaroid film has a magic that I’ve found in no other film. I think that’s why when the Polaroid Corporation announced in February of 2008 that they were discontinuing the product, many were upset and scrabbled to stock up on the instant film. I have a SX-70 from the 1970s and when in 2006, they phased out its “Time-Zero” film I stocked up and even now have boxes of the film in my refrigerator.

 

For those of us who love Polaroids, it’s hard to explain the beauty we find in the film. With its magic, the polaroid forces us to pay attention to the subject within its frame. It elevates the instant scientific artifact to the level of fine art.  While shooting, the photographer is obliged to reevaluate ordinary objects around them and strip them to their simplest elements of color, shape, and texture.
